Say whether each of the following is a rule, a strategy, or a payoff.
a. In chess, when you capture your opponent’s king, you win the game.
b. In Monopoly, players frequently mortgage their existing properties to raise cash to buy new ones.
c. In chess, the rook piece can move any number of spaces directly forward, back-ward, or to either side, but it cannot move diagonally.
d. In rock-paper-scissors, you might always play rock.
